CHECK POWER MANAGEMENT CONTROL ECU
Disconnect the A21, L5 and L6 connectors.
Measure the voltage and res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
| Tester Connection | Wiring Color | Terminal Description | Condition |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A21-2 (IG2D) - Body ground | V - Body ground | IG2 relay operation signal | Always | 131 to 230 Ω |
| A21-23 (STP) - Body ground | L - Body ground | Stop light switch signal | Brake pedal depressed | 11 to 14 V |
| A21-23 (STP) - Body ground | L - Body ground | Stop light switch signal | Brake pedal released | Below 1 V |
| L5-1 (AM22) - Body ground | W - Body ground | +B power supply | Always | 9.5 to 16 V |
| L6-7 (AM21) - Body ground | W - Body ground | +B power supply | Always | 9.5 to 16 V |
| L5-6 (E1) - Body ground | BR -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| L6-4 (E12) - Body ground | BR -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| L6-24 (CA1L) - Body ground | W -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L6-25 (CA1H) - Body ground | B -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L6-17 (SSW2) - Body ground | Y - Body ground | Power switch signal | Power switch pushed | Below 1 Ω |
| L6-17 (SSW2) - Body ground | Y - Body ground | Power switch signal | Power switch not pushed |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L5-7 (SSW1) - Body ground | B - Body ground | Power switch signal | Power switch pushed | Below 1 Ω |
| L5-7 (SSW1) - Body ground | B - Body ground | Power switch signal | Power switch not pushed |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L6-1 (ACCD) - Body ground | G - Body ground | ACC relay operation signal | Always | 50.625 to 61.875 Ω |
| L6-2 (IG1D) - Body ground | B - Body ground | IG1 relay operation signal | Always | 50.625 to 61.875 Ω |
| L6-11 (LIN2) - Body ground | L - Body ground | LIN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
If the result is not as specified, there may be a malfunction in the wire harness.
Reconnect the A21, L5 and L6 connectors.
Measure the voltage and check for pulses according to the value(s) in the table below.
| Tester Connection | Wiring Color | Terminal Description | Condition |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A21-2 (IG2D) - L5-6 (E1) | V - BR | IG2 signal | Power switch on (IG) | Output voltage at terminal AM21 or AM22 is -2 V or more |
| A21-2 (IG2D) - L5-6 (E1) | V - BR | IG2 signal | Power switch on (ACC) | Below 1 V |
| L5-9 (INDW) - L5-6 (E1) | G - BR | Warning signal | Brake pedal depressed, park (P) selected, power switch on (ACC, IG) | 8 to 14 V |
| A21-22 (PCON) - L5-6 (E1) | LG - BR | P position signal | Park (P) selected | Pulse generation (See waveform 1) |
| A21-28 (PPOS) - L5-6 (E1) | W - BR | P position signal | Park (P) selected | Pulse generation (See waveform 1) |
| L6-17 (SSW2) - L5-6 (E1) | Y - BR | Power switch signal | Power switch not pushed | Output voltage at terminal AM21 or AM22 is -2 V or more |
| L6-17 (SSW2) - L5-6 (E1) | Y - BR | Power switch signal | Power switch pushed | Below 1 V |
| L5-7 (SSW1) - L5-6 (E1) | B - BR | Power switch signal | Power switch not pushed | Output voltage at terminal AM21 or AM22 is -2 V or more |
| L5-7 (SSW1) - L5-6 (E1) | B - BR | Power switch signal | Power switch pushed | Below 1 V |
| L6-1 (ACCD) - L5-6 (E1) | G - BR | ACC signal | Power switch on (ACC) | Output voltage at terminal AM21 or AM22 is -2 V or more |
| L6-1 (ACCD) - L5-6 (E1) | G - BR | ACC signal | Power switch off | Below 1 V |
| L6-2 (IG1D) - L5-6 (E1) | B - BR | IG1 signal | Power switch on (IG) | Output voltage at terminal AM21 or AM22 is -2 V or more |
| L6-2 (IG1D) - L5-6 (E1) | B - BR | IG1 signal | Power switch on (ACC) | Below 1 V |
| L5-8 (INDS) - L5-6 (E1) | R - BR | Vehicle condition signal | Brake pedal depressed, park (P) selected | 8 to 14 V |
| L5-14 (SPDI) - L5-6 (E1) | V - BR | Vehicle speed signal | Power switch on (IG), wheel rotated slowly | Pulse generation (See waveform 2) |
| L6-20 (IMO) - L5-6 (E1) | L - BR | Immobiliser communication status | Immobiliser communicating | Pulse generation (See waveform 3) |
| L6-21 (IMI) - L5-6 (E1) | R - BR | Immobiliser communication status | Immobiliser communicating | Pulse generation (See waveform 4) |
If the result is not as specified, the ECU may have a malfunction.

CHECK CERTIFICATION ECU (SMART KEY ECU ASSEMBLY)
Disconnect the L56 connector.
Measure the voltage and res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
| Tester Connection | Wiring Color | Terminal Description | Condition |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| L56-1 (+B) - Body ground | B - Body ground | +B power supply | Always | 11 to 14 V |
| L56-9 (CANH) - Body ground | BE -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L56-10 (CANL) - Body ground | P -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| L56-15 (E) - Body ground | W-B -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| L56-16 (IG) - Body ground | BE - Body ground | IG power supply | Power switch on (IG) | 11 to 14 V |
| L56-29 (LIN) - Body ground | L - Body ground | LIN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
If the result is not as specified, there may be a malfunction in the wire harness.
CHECK TRANSMISSION CONTROL ECU ASSEMBLY
Disconnect the A22 and A23 connectors.
Measure the voltage and res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
| Tester Connection | Wiring Color | Terminal Description | Condition |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A23-1 (E1) - Body ground | BR -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| A23-5 (E02) - Body ground | W-B -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| A23-6 (E01) - Body ground | W-B -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| A22-16 (+B) - Body ground | L - Body ground | Ignition power supply | Power switch on (IG) | 11 to 14 V |
| A22-16 (+B) - Body ground | L - Body ground | Ignition power supply | Power switch off | Below 1 V |
| A22-15 (BATT) - Body ground | SB - Body ground | +B power supply | Except power switch on (READY) | 11 to 14 V |
| A22-15 (BATT) - Body ground | SB - Body ground | +B power supply | Power switch on (READY) | 11 to 15.5 V |
| A23-15 (CA1L) - Body ground | P -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| A23-16 (CA1H) - Body ground | BE - Body ground | CAN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
| A23-24 (LIN) - Body ground | L - Body ground | LIN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
If the result is not as specified, there may be a malfunction in the wire harness.
CHECK ID CODE BOX (IMMOBILISER CODE ECU) [w/o Wireless Buzzer Answer-back Function]
Disconnect the L10 connector.
Measure the resistance and vo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.
| Tester Connection | Wiring Color | Terminal Description | Condition |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| L10-1 (+B) - L10-8 (GND) | B - W-B | +B power supply | Always | 11 to 14 V |
| L10-8 (GND) - Body ground | W-B - Body ground | Ground | Always | Below 1 Ω |
| L10-3 (LIN1) - Body ground | L - Body ground | LIN communication line | Always | 10 kΩ or higher |
If the result is not as specified, there may be a malfunction in the wire harness.
